OVERVIEW The University of Strathclyde is seeking an International UG Administrative Assistant to support the Strathclyde Institute of Pharmacy & Biomedical Sciences. This administrative role focuses on undergraduate and postgraduate taught programmes, with particular involvement in biomedical sciences programmes. The position requires strong organisational skills and provides support for international programmes connected with partner institutions in china and Jordan. The successful candidate will join the administration teaching team and contribute to the effective delivery of student-facing and programme-related activities. Experience in student administration within higher or further education and familiarity with admissions or student record systems would be advantageous.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ES – Provide administrative support for undergraduate and postgraduate taught programmes – Support biomedical sciences programmes within the institute – Assist in all aspects of undergraduate secretarial support – Take primary responsibility for administration linked to international programmes – Support collaborative programmes with China Pharmaceutical University in Nanjing, china – Support collaborative programmes with the Middle Eastern University in Amman, Jordan – Work as part of the administration teaching team – Contribute to effective programme administration and coordination REQUIREMENTS – Excellent organisational skills – Competent and enthusiastic approach to administrative work – Ability to support undergraduate and postgraduate programmes – Experience of student administration in higher or further education is advantageous – Knowledge of student record systems would be advantageous – Knowledge of admissions systems would be advantageous WHY THIS ROLE MATTERS Administrative professionals play an important role in ensuring that university programmes operate effectively and that student support processes run smoothly.
